首页 > 解决方案 > 按升序对浮点数列表中的数字进行分组

问题描述

我有一个随机数的浮点列表,如下所示:

float_list=[7.1, 7.1, 8.3, 8.5, 6.7,6.8, 6.9, 4.0, 4.2, 9.0]

我想用元组组织列表,如下所示:

float_list=[(7.1, 7.1, 8.3, 8.5), (6.7, 6.8,6.9), (4.0, 4.2, 9.0)]

我尝试使用 itertools 中的 group_by 方法,但无法获得预期的结果。我已经看到了这个解决方案,但这不是我要问的,我有不同的增量浮动。

标签: pythonpython-3.x

解决方案


推荐阅读